Understanding the Market and Your Audience
Securing contracts for energy storage battery packs requires more than technical specs – it demands sharp insight into evolving market needs. Let's break down the landscape:
- Key industries driving demand: Renewable integration (solar/wind), grid stabilization, and commercial backup systems
- Decision-makers: Procurement managers (35%), engineering teams (40%), sustainability officers (25%) based on 2023 industry surveys
- Critical pain points: Cycle life (85% prioritize), safety certifications (92% require), and thermal management (78% emphasize)

FAQ
- Q: What certifications are mandatory for grid-scale projects?A: UL1973, IEC62619, and local grid codes
- Q: How to calculate required battery capacity?A: Use peak demand x autonomy hours ÷ depth of discharge
